Linear Technology LT3511 high-voltage switching regulator

Linear Technology has announced the LT3511, a high-voltage isolated monolithic flyback switching regulator that simplifies the design of an isolated DC/DC converter.

No optocoupler, third winding or signal transformer is required for feedback since the output voltage is sensed from the primary-side flyback signal. The device operates over a 4.5 to 100 V input, has a 240 mA, 150 V power switch and delivers up to 2.5 W, making it suitable for a wide variety of telecom, datacom, motor vehicle, industrial and medical applications.

The regulator operates in a boundary mode, a current-mode control switching scheme, resulting in ±5% typical regulation over the full line, load and temperature range. Boundary mode, also known as critical conduction mode, permits the use of a smaller transformer compared with equivalent continuous conduction mode designs. The output voltage is easily set by two external resistors and the transformer turns ratio.

Several transformers identified in the data sheet can be used for numerous applications.

Additional features include an onboard low dropout regulator for IC power, undervoltage lockout and output voltage temperature compensation.
